Possible Causes of Attic Water Damage
One of the most frequent causes of attic water damage is roof leaks, especially after heavy rain or storms. Damaged or missing shingles, weakened roof flashing, or poor insulation around vents can allow water to penetrate your attic space. In some cases, clogged gutters cause water to overflow and seep into your roofline, exacerbating the problem.
Another common cause is plumbing issues, such as leaking pipes orHVAC condensation buildup. If plumbing pipes running through or near the attic leak, moisture can rapidly spread across insulation, ceiling joists, and drywall. Poor ventilation can also trap excess moisture, creating a humid environment that promotes mold growth and wood decay. Identifying the root cause is crucial to ensure a proper and lasting solution.

How can I tell if my attic has water damage?
If you notice water stains, a musty smell, or mold growth in your attic, these are clear signs of water damage. Discoloration on insulation or drywall and warped wood are also indicators. If you suspect leaks, it’s best to contact professionals for an inspection.

What steps can I take to prevent future attic water damage?
Regular roof inspections, gutter maintenance, proper attic ventilation, and sealing any cracks or vulnerabilities can significantly reduce the risk of water damage. Scheduling routine checkups with our experts can help maintain your attic’s integrity over time.
